Quinn Ewers, Texas A&M injury update: Texas QB off injury report, trio of Aggies game time decisions
Quinn Ewers is off the injury report for Texas heading into a rivalry showdown with Texas A&M. The quarterback had been progressing toward playing all week.
As for the Aggies, a trio of players are going to be game time decisions: running back Rueben Owens and defensive backs Jaydon Hill and Will Lee III. They were all questionable on Friday.
Kickoff between the Longhorns and Aggies — and the restoring of a storied rivalry — is scheduled for 7:30 p.m. EST.

Full Texas-Texas A&M final injury report
Texas:
DB Derek Williams Jr. – Out
RB CJ Baxter – Out
RB Christian Clark – Out
RB Velton Gardner – Out
Texas A&M:
WR Cyrus Allen – Out
DB Tyreek Chappell – Out
RB Le’Veon Moss – Out
OL Mark Nabou Jr. – Out
QB Jaylen Henderson – Out
RB Rueben Owens – Game time decision
DB Jaydon Hill – Game time decision
DB Will Lee III – Game time decision
